Flagstone Sealing in Puyallup, WA
Flagstone sealing services involve applying a protective coating to flagstone surfaces to enhance their durability and appearance. This service is commonly used on patios, walkways, driveways, and garden paths to prevent damage from moisture, staining, and everyday wear. Property owners typically want to understand how sealing can extend the lifespan of their stone surfaces, improve their visual appeal, and reduce the need for future repairs or cleaning. Before requesting a sealing service, it’s helpful to consider the current condition of the flagstone, whether it has been previously sealed, and the desired finish-such as matte or glossy-that best complements the property’s aesthetic.
When planning flagstone sealing, property owners often inquire about the types of sealants available, how often the surface should be resealed, and any surface preparation required beforehand. It’s important to ensure the stone is clean and dry prior to sealing to achieve the best results. Additionally, understanding the specific needs of the flagstone material-such as porosity and exposure to weather-can help determine the most suitable sealing products and techniques. Proper sealing can protect flagstone surfaces from staining, erosion, and moisture intrusion, contributing to the long-term beauty and integrity of outdoor spaces.

Flagstone Sealing Questions
What is flagstone sealing? Flagstone sealing involves applying a protective coating to enhance durability and resist stains on flagstone surfaces.
Why should flagstone be sealed? Sealing helps prevent water penetration, reduces staining, and extends the lifespan of the flagstone.
Which areas are suitable for flagstone sealing? Flagstone sealing is ideal for patios, walkways, driveways, and other outdoor surfaces exposed to weather elements.
How often should flagstone be resealed? Resealing typically occurs every few years to maintain protection and appearance, depending on usage and exposure.
